What is an E-Learning Developer job?

An E-Learning Developer is responsible for designing, developing, and implementing online learning materials and courses. They use instructional design principles, multimedia tools, and e-learning software to create engaging and interactive content. Their role often involves collaborating with subject matter experts, graphic designers, and other stakeholders to ensure effective learning experiences. Additionally, they may be responsible for maintaining and updating e-learning content to keep it relevant and accessible.

How to become an e-learning developer?

To become an e-learning developer, you typically need a bachelor's degree in education, instructional design, computer science, or a related field. Developing skills in e-learning authoring tools like Articulate Storyline or Adobe Captivate, along with knowledge of multimedia production and learning theories, is essential. Gaining experience through internships or project work can also help build a strong portfolio for this role.

What Does an eLearning Developer Do?

As an eLearning developer, you design and implement the structure of online courses using eLearning tools, such as instructional software and applications. You take the blueprint for the course, including content that has been created by an instructional developer, and design and code the lessons. Your duties and responsibilities are to make the lessons visually appealing and engaging while effectively conveying the lessons to students or users. As an eLearning developer, you may work for an education company or a company that designs instructional tools and solutions for employee training.

What skills are needed for an e-learning developer?

An e-learning developer needs strong skills in instructional design, multimedia creation, and e-learning authoring tools such as Articulate Storyline or Adobe Captivate. Proficiency in programming languages like HTML, CSS, or JavaScript, along with good project management and communication skills, are also important for creating effective online learning experiences.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the E Learning Developer position, and why are they important?

To thrive as an E Learning Developer, you need expertise in instructional design, multimedia creation, and a solid understanding of adult learning principles, typically supported by a relevant degree like instructional technology or education. Familiarity with Learning Management Systems (LMS) such as Moodle or Canvas, authoring tools like Articulate Storyline or Adobe Captivate, and experience with SCORM or xAPI standards are highly valuable. Strong project management, creative problem-solving, and effective communication skills help you collaborate and translate complex subjects into engaging online content. These competencies are critical for creating high-quality, impactful learning experiences that meet organizational and learner goals.

What are some common challenges E Learning Developers face in this role?

E Learning Developers often encounter challenges such as adapting content to suit diverse learners, ensuring accessibility compliance, and keeping up with rapidly evolving educational technologies. They may need to collaborate closely with subject matter experts who have varying levels of familiarity with digital tools, making clear communication essential. Managing tight project deadlines while maintaining high engagement and interactivity standards can also be demanding. However, overcoming these common challenges can be highly rewarding, as it directly contributes to the effectiveness and reach of educational programs.

Job description

The Multimedia Learning Content Producer is responsible for leading the design, capture, and production of video-first multimedia learning content for ABS learning solutions. This role focuses primarily on the media production side of learning (video recording, editing, and post-production) , while also supporting instructional design efforts to create engaging and effective training experiences. This position is based out of our Global Headquarters in the Greater Houston area with a hybrid schedule requiring a minimum of 3 days on-site.

What You Will Do:

  • Lead video production efforts for training and development programs, including recording, editing, and post-production of curriculum content.
  • Capture high-quality video and audio for eLearning modules, training programs, and internal communications.
  • Collaborate with instructional designers and SMEs to translate learning concepts into engaging multimedia assets using adult learning principles (ADDIE, 6Ds, etc.).
  • Plan and develop storyboards, shot lists, and media concepts to support curriculum objectives.
  • Edit video content, incorporating motion graphics, sound design, and special effects to deliver polished final products.
  • Design, create, modify, and deliver multimedia assets , including video, audio, graphics, and animations (2D/3D as appropriate).
  • Determine the most effective visual and audio formats, approaches, and delivery methods for learning content.
  • Support the development of eLearning content, including visual design, media integration, and course enhancements.
  • Maintain and organize digital media libraries and ensure all assets meet quality and brand standards.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to deliver projects on time and at a high level of quality.
  • Stay current on emerging media production tools, technologies, and trends to enhance learning experiences.

What You Will Need:

Education and Experience

  • Bachelor's degree in Multimedia Design, Instructional Technology, Graphic Design, or related field (or equivalent experience).
  • Minimum 3+ years of hands-on multimedia and video production experience , including filming, editing, and post-production.
  • At least 2 years of experience supporting instructional design or eLearning development .
  • Strong experience with Adobe Creative Suite (Premiere Pro, After Effects, Photoshop, Illustrator, InDesign, etc.) is required.
  • Experience with audio and video production tools (e.g., Audition, Audacity, Pro Tools) is required.
  • Experience in technical industries (marine, engineering, oil & gas) is preferred.

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ities

  • Strong expertise in video production , including shooting, lighting, audio capture, and editing.
  • Understanding of instructional design principles and adult learning theory and their application to multimedia content.
  • Ability to design and develop engaging multimedia learning experiences across formats (video, web, interactive content).
  • Experience creating storyboards, scripts, and visual concepts for training content.
  • Ability to manage multiple projects, timelines, and deadlines with strong organizational skills.
  • Strong collaboration skills and ability to work effectively with SMEs, stakeholders, and creative teams.
  • Working knowledge of 2D/3D animation and multimedia tools (e.g., Blender, 3ds Max) is a plus.
  • Familiarity with Articulate Storyline or other eLearning development tools is a plus.
  • Basic knowledge of HTML5, CSS, or interactive media development is a plus.
  • Strong problem-solving skills and ability to adapt to changing project needs and priorities.
  • Excellent communication and client service skills with a proactive, team-oriented mindset.
  • Working knowledge of the ABS Health, Safety, Quality & Environmental Management System.
